Transaction 59bd133e7f940ed6fc4dfc555d5a1e3eaf21bed96fc2cf31847a102bd591f183
1 Input
1 Output
-
59bd133e7f940ed6fc4dfc555d5a1e3eaf21bed96fc2cf31847a102bd591f183:0
- value
- 8453558
- script pubkey
- OP_0 OP_PUSHBYTES_20 20ad2b5e4f53ec31c52add5d206386e829efca9f
- address
- bc1qyzkjkhj020krr3f2m4wjqcuxaq57lj5l8ej3jg